### Webhook Retry Semantics — Marlowick Dispatcher

Failed webhook deliveries are retried with exponential backoff plus jitter. After the final attempt, the event moves to the dead-letter store and a notice is posted to the delivery dashboard. Receivers returning 410 are disabled immediately and skip retries entirely. All retry behavior is driven by the values shown below.

settings of fafog-haduf:
ZORIX_PIN=4648
ZORIX_METRICS_HOST=metrics.zorix.paliqsys.corp
ZORIX_LOG_LEVEL=info
ZORIX_TENANT=druix

UserSplit Cutover Drift: the extracted account service and the legacy Marigold monolith user module are reporting divergent record counts during dual-write. This fires when drift exceeds 0.5% over 15 minutes. New team members should not replay writes manually. Reconciliation steps and the rollback procedure are documented on the internal page.

wiki page, tajog-fafog: https://gitlab.paliqsys.corp/dash/display/job/853dd6fcbf54

Handover note — Crumbwheel order cutoffs.

Welcome aboard. The bakery cutoff rule in Crumbwheel closes same-day orders at 14:00 local to each storefront, not UTC — this has bitten us twice. Holiday overrides live in the calendar service and take precedence silently, so always check there first when a cutoff looks wrong. To unlock the calendar service's admin console after a restart, enter the recovery passphrase below.

vault phrase of bagap-bahaf = silion-pelox-sorox-casdor-quenwyn-fraax-eliox-praael-kelion-quenvan-kasox-rusael-norius-belvan

// TILE_PREFETCH_RADIUS: ring of tiles fetched ahead of viewport in Wayfern.
// Bumping past 3 blew cache on the Ostlund edge nodes last sprint; keep at 2
// until the eviction fix lands. Verified against the Pellam route benchmark,
// no regression. If prefetch misses spike again, quote the trace token that
// the profiler emits at startup.

trace token, fafog-kageg: htk4_98e6